Practical, experience-based learning for leadership, collaboration, and navigating change. 

Our seminars and workshops give leaders and teams the tools to grow essential skills – from effective communication and decision-making to psychological resilience, conflict resolution, and leading through change. The content is practical, grounded in everyday work situations, and based on organizational psychology and coaching practices. 

Examples of Topics 

  • Conscious Change Management 
  • Leading Difficult Conversations 
  • Conflict Resolution, Listening, and Building Trust in Teams 
  • Post-Change Reflection and Growth Planning 
  • Emotional Intelligence and Stress Resilience 
  • Supporting Colleagues in Stressful Situations 
  • Workplace Mobbing and Organizational Responsibility 

Format and Customization 

All workshops are tailored to your organization’s needs and participant experience level. Formats include: 

  • Practical team workshops (3–4 hours) 
  • Leadership seminars (half-day or full-day) 
  • Leadership team training programs (structured series over 2–4 months) 
  • Internal training events or conference sessions 

Many seminars can also be delivered remotely

Facilitator 

Laura Šīmane-Vīgante 
Work and organizational psychologist, certified coach, leadership consultant, and psychological assessment specialist with over 15 years of experience in talent and organizational development. 

She has worked as a lecturer and associate professor at three Latvian universities, designing and teaching more than 36 courses in psychology, social work, education, and career counseling. Laura is skilled at translating academic knowledge into practical, applicable solutions for diverse audiences. Her core areas of expertise include psychological assessment, personality and team dynamics, and the development of leaders and high-potential employees.
